A Study Comparing Sotorasib With Durvalumab in People With Non-Small Cell Lung Cancer (NSCLC)
Sponsor: Memorial Sloan Kettering Cancer Center
Summary
In this study, the researchers will look at whether having participants switch from durvalumab to sotorasib when they have detectable minimal residual disease (MRD) is an effective treatment approach for locally advanced non-small cell lung cancer (LA-NSCLC). The researchers will see whether this switch to sotorasib can control LANSCLC longer compared to the treatment approach of staying on durvalumab (and not switching to sotorasib).
Official title: A Randomized Phase II Study of Sotorasib Versus Continued Consolidation Durvalumab in Patients With KRAS G12C Mutant Locally Advanced Non-small Cell Lung Cancer (LANSCLC) With Persistent ctDNA Defined Minimal Residual Disease
